Do you consider yourself to be a highly organized and enthusiastic team player who excels working in a fast paced and high volume environment? If so, consider joining the Aviation, Forest Fire and Emergency Services team within the Ministry of Natural Resources and Forestry.
As the Aviation Support Clerk you will have the opportunity to apply your exceptional administrative and organizational skills to provide support to the Aviation Services Section.
About the job
In this role, you will:
• respond to general inquiries in-person, over the phone and by email
• sort, record and distribute correspondence and incoming mail
• review flight logs for errors or omissions and maintain aircraft technical records as required
• prepare, update and review a variety of material such as manuals, training records, correspondence, reports and log sheets
• coordinate and monitor vehicle logs, daily sign out sheets and invoices for rental/leased vehicles
• make travel arrangements and coordinate logistics for meetings and conferences
• maintain and ensure sufficient levels of office supplies
